Lines Matching defs:DescriptorAddressInfoEXT
23519 struct DescriptorAddressInfoEXT struct
23521 using NativeType = VkDescriptorAddressInfoEXT;
23523 static const bool allowDuplicate = false;
23524 …KAN_HPP_CONST_OR_CONSTEXPR StructureType structureType = StructureType::eDescriptorAddressInfoEXT;
23527 … VULKAN_HPP_CONSTEXPR DescriptorAddressInfoEXT( VULKAN_HPP_NAMESPACE::DeviceAddress address_ = {}, in DescriptorAddressInfoEXT() function
23540 DescriptorAddressInfoEXT( VkDescriptorAddressInfoEXT const & rhs ) VULKAN_HPP_NOEXCEPT in DescriptorAddressInfoEXT() function
23550 *this = *reinterpret_cast<VULKAN_HPP_NAMESPACE::DescriptorAddressInfoEXT const *>( &rhs ); in operator =()
23555 VULKAN_HPP_CONSTEXPR_14 DescriptorAddressInfoEXT & setPNext( void * pNext_ ) VULKAN_HPP_NOEXCEPT in setPNext()
23561 …ptorAddressInfoEXT & setAddress( VULKAN_HPP_NAMESPACE::DeviceAddress address_ ) VULKAN_HPP_NOEXCEPT in setAddress()
23567 … DescriptorAddressInfoEXT & setRange( VULKAN_HPP_NAMESPACE::DeviceSize range_ ) VULKAN_HPP_NOEXCEPT in setRange()
23573 …14 DescriptorAddressInfoEXT & setFormat( VULKAN_HPP_NAMESPACE::Format format_ ) VULKAN_HPP_NOEXCEPT in setFormat()
23580 operator VkDescriptorAddressInfoEXT const &() const VULKAN_HPP_NOEXCEPT in operator VkDescriptorAddressInfoEXT const&()
23585 operator VkDescriptorAddressInfoEXT &() VULKAN_HPP_NOEXCEPT in operator VkDescriptorAddressInfoEXT&()
23600 reflect() const VULKAN_HPP_NOEXCEPT in reflect()
23609 bool operator==( DescriptorAddressInfoEXT const & rhs ) const VULKAN_HPP_NOEXCEPT in operator ==()
23618 bool operator!=( DescriptorAddressInfoEXT const & rhs ) const VULKAN_HPP_NOEXCEPT in operator !=()
23625 VULKAN_HPP_NAMESPACE::StructureType sType = StructureType::eDescriptorAddressInfoEXT;
23626 void * pNext = {};
23627 VULKAN_HPP_NAMESPACE::DeviceAddress address = {};
23628 VULKAN_HPP_NAMESPACE::DeviceSize range = {};
23629 VULKAN_HPP_NAMESPACE::Format format = VULKAN_HPP_NAMESPACE::Format::eUndefined;